Define electrode.

  • -1

A solid electrical conductor through which an electric current enters or leaves something like a dry cell or an electrolytic cell , is called an electrode.

Anelectrodeis an Electrical conductorused to make contact with a nonmetallic part of a circuit(e.g. a semiconductor , an electrolyte or a vacuum) .The word was coined by the scientist Michael Faraday.
